In her much-anticipated foray into the horror-thriller genre, Golden Globe and Emmy nominee Taylor Schilling stars in THE PRODIGY as Sarah, a mother whose young son Miles' disturbing behavior signals that an evil, possibly supernatural force has overtaken him. Fearing for her family's safety, Sarah must choose between her maternal instinct to love and protect Miles and a desperate need to investigate what or who is causing his dark turn. She is forced to look for answers in the past, taking the audience on a wild ride; one where the line between perception and reality becomes frighteningly blurry.

    The Prodigy is a new horror film directed by Nicholas McCarthy, the director of The Pact, Home and Holidays. In the film, Sarah (Taylor Schilling) has just received her first child. Her son Miles (Jackson Robert Scott) seems to be a special child from a young age with a clever intelligence and a high pain threshold. Furthermore, Miles also shows strange disturbing behavior. When she has Miles tested, nothing special comes out of the research results. Only a spiritual researcher assumes that two different souls live in Miles. Miles his own soul and the soul of a reincarnated person who has not yet finished his life on earth. This soul belongs to a malicious man who tries to find and kill his escaped victim. Sarah is faced with a choice to help the evil soul and get her son back or to have her son locked up in a special institution so that the evil soul can not do any damage to the world. This film is quickly told in a predictable way thanks to the information you get as a viewer at the beginning of the film. They could have left this information better from the beginning and could only tell later in the film. So the only question you can have as a viewer while watching the movie is which soul has control of the body of Miles. Usually the events and actions of the characters quickly give away who has the control. Due to the predictability of the film, the film soon becomes a bit tedious, because as a viewer you know what to expect. For example, the horror moments in the film are not really scary anymore. It is not clearly explained how reincarnation has happened in the film. It is simply stated that it is reincarnation without further explanation. The same type of horror story about reincarnation has been used in other horror films as in the Child's Play films. In these films, the soul of a murderer has entered an innocent doll by using a voodoo ritual, in order to create further chaos in the world. The acting is well done by the protagonists. Jackson Robert Scott delivers good acting in this horror film for a young actor. In the remake of the horror film It also provided good acting as the young Georgie. Taylor Schilling also provides good assault as the mother, who is confronted with the two souls in the body of her son and the choices she is faced with. The acting of the two carries the film. The rest of the cast is not very special in the film. This is mainly because their characters have little more to do.

    After seeing the trailer a couple of time I was quite excited for this movie. When I heard they had to edit some scenes because they were to scary for the test-audience I thought I would finally be seeing an actual horror movie. Unfortunately, this movie did not deliver for me. There were only two scary shots, one which was in the trailer. Furthermore, the movie explained way too much, way too soon for me, following a standard formula without any true twist. There wasn't anything to second guess, no 'did he or didn't he?', no other explanations or roads explored. A very straightforward movie that wasn't all that scary. Disappointing.
